On upper bounds for toroidal mosaic numbers

Abstract:In this paper, we construct mosaic representations of knots on the torus, rather than in the plane. This consists of a particular choice of the ambient group $mathbb{A }$ , as well as different Definitions of contiguous and suitably connected. We present conditions under which mosaic numbers might decrease by this projection, and present a tool (called waste) to measure this reduction. We show that the order of edge identification in construction of the torus sometimes yields different resultant knots from a given mosaic when reversed. Additionally, in the Appendix we give the catalog of all torus $2$ -mosaics.
